About Londa Village

Londa is a mid sized village in Dumaria tehsil, in the district of Gaya, Bihar. The Census of India 2011 recorded a population of 556, made up of 271 males and 285 females. That works out to a sex ratio of about 1,052 females per 1000 males. The village covers 93 hectares hectares.

Getting to Londa

The census records public bus service for Londa as Available within 5 - 10 km distance. Private bus service is recorded as Available within village. For rail, the census notes the nearest railway station as Available within 10+ km distance. These entries describe what was recorded in 2011 and services may have changed since.
